XML 59 R46.htm IDEA: XBRL DOCUMENT v3.22.4
Acquisitions, Goodwill And Other Intangible Assets (Summary of Estimated Amortization Expense) (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Dec. 31, 2020
Finite-Lived Intangible Assets      
Amortization expense $ 56,373 $ 47,565 $ 37,873
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 56,217    
2020 54,353    
2021 50,043    
2022 46,962    
2023 44,863    
Cost of Sales      
Finite-Lived Intangible Assets      
Amortization expense 10,155 5,783 5,101
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 9,834    
2020 9,486    
2021 8,507    
2022 7,280    
2023 6,137    
Selling, General and Administrative Expenses      
Finite-Lived Intangible Assets      
Amortization expense 46,218 $ 41,782 $ 32,772
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 46,383    
2020 44,867    
2021 41,536    
2022 39,682    
2023 $ 38,726